Used Car Viewing Checklist

Before viewing a used vehicle, prepare questions about title, service history, inspection status, tires, brakes, and warning lights.

01

Confirm the appointment, title status, mileage, and asking price before you arrive.

02

Look for warning lights, fluid leaks, tire wear, body-panel gaps, and uneven paint.

03

Ask what is known, what is unknown, and what should be inspected before purchase.
